Procuring high-performance nickel alloys for mission-critical components requires more than just raw material; it demands verifiable metallurgical integrity and dimensional precision. Inconel X-750 (UNS N07750) is a precipitation-hardenable superalloy specifically engineered for applications demanding high tensile strength at temperatures up to 700°C and exceptional resistance to relaxation at moderate temperatures. Metallurgical Integrity: Composition & Heat Treatment

The defining characteristic of Inconel X-750 is its age-hardening capability, driven by the precipitation of the ordered face-centered cubic gamma prime [γ′—Ni₃(Al, Ti, Nb)] phase. To ensure the alloy performs as specified, Shanghai COCESS Special Alloys Co., Ltd​ strictly controls the melt practices and thermal processing:

  • Chemical Composition (wt.%):​ Ni ≥ 70.0, Cr 14.0–17.0, Fe 5.0–9.0, Ti 2.25–2.75, Al 0.40–1.00, Nb+Ta 0.70–1.20, C ≤ 0.08. This precise balance ensures optimal γ′ volume fraction for strength without compromising ductility.

  • Heat Treatment State:​ Our stock is typically supplied in the Solution Treated + Stabilized + Aged​ condition (e.g., 1150°C AC + 845°C AC + 705°C AC + 620°C AC). This multi-stage process is critical to dissolve primary carbides, stabilize grain boundaries, and precipitate a fine, uniform dispersion of γ′ phase, resulting in a typical hardness of HRC 32–38​ and yield strength exceeding 965 MPa.

Technical Advantages for Machining & Fabrication

Selecting the right stock form minimizes downstream manufacturing challenges:

  • Machinability:​ While Inconel X-750 work-hardens rapidly, our stock is supplied in a heat-treated condition optimized for chip breaking and tool life. We recommend using rigid setups, positive rake angles, and high-pressure coolant to manage the alloy’s inherent toughness.

  • Weldability:​ The alloy exhibits good weldability using conventional techniques (GTAW, GMAW). However, due to the precipitation-hardening nature, post-weld heat treatment (PWHT) is often required to restore the heat-affected zone (HAZ) properties to match the base metal strength, especially for pressure-retaining components.

  • Formability:​ Cold heading and thread rolling are viable for smaller diameter bars (≤ Ø25mm) in the annealed condition, provided sufficient lubrication and slow feed rates are used to mitigate work hardening.

Inventory Applications & Quality Documentation

Our Inconel X-750 round bar stock is routinely utilized for:

  • Aerospace Fasteners:​ High-strength bolts, studs, and nuts for turbine engines and airframes, leveraging the alloy's retention of preload at 540°C–650°C.

  • Elastic Components:​ Precision springs, diaphragms, and seals for high-temperature valves and actuators.

  • Tooling & Fixtures:​ Durable mandrels, forming dies, and heat-treat fixtures for the automotive and aerospace industries.
